Happy Retirement Joyce!

After working with us at DCAS for the last fourteen years, Joyce Sawford is retiring!!

Joyce brought so much to us at DCAS firstly through her work on our accountancy book, “The Adventures of Mr Claw in the World of Charity Accountancy,” a book still available from the DCAS office, then the DCAS Newsletter and finally managing our website.

We are really grateful for all Joyce has done for us!!!

Since Joyce became an employee with us in 2011 things have not all been sunshine and rainbows.

We suffered the loss of our President Ted Cassidy, the person who started DCAS in 1991 and was always there to support us.

We lost three fantastic trustees, Andrew Buxton, Dave Goss and Ted Rasey all of whom brought amazing skills to us.

We also lost two members of staff, Maggie Mallender who worked for DCAS and Sue Jones who supported Ted Cassidy and Mark in the 1990s.

Their contributions to DCAS were massive and they will always be with us through the work that we do.

If this was not bad enough, DCAS like all other Derby groups, suffered the ending of Derby City Council funding in 2016.

Then of course COVID struck….

But in the words of a song called “The Wish”, ”If you are looking for a sad song, we ain’t going to play!”

Here at DCAS we are very proud of all we have achieved over the last 14 years. So a massive thanks to everyone who has been there for us and especially to the voluntary groups who have continued to use our services and of course to Joyce on her retirement!!
